 With A Dog’s Purpose, you will have to make several concessions. It is a hopelessly cute tearjerker that is is mind-numbingly simple in the way it is crafted. And while it brazenly blackmails you emotionally at several moments in its one-hour-forty-minutes long runtime, you don’t really mind because those are the same things that work in its favour. A tale of a reincarnating Golden Retriever, the film is based on the book by the same name. While it gets the concept of reincarnation completely wrong; that’s not where the film is aiming to go. All the makers are looking to do is to make you tear up. With aww-worthy moments galore, you don’t mind the gaps in the movie’s logic.

A Dog's Purpose Story: 
A devoted dog (Josh Gad) discovers the meaning of its own existence through the lives of the humans it teaches to laugh and love. Reincarnated as multiple canines over the course of five decades, the lovable pooch develops an unbreakable bond with a kindred spirit named Ethan (Bryce Gheisar). As the boy grows older and comes to a crossroad, the dog once again comes back into his life to remind him of his true self.
